概括
社会欺骗,即个人从群体努力中受益而没有贡献,存在于诸如Myxococcus xanthus. 这项研究发现,在群体发育过程中,细菌突变体中存在作弊行为.

背景情况:
- 社会欺骗在合作系统中是一个挑战,因为个人成本超过了集体收益.
- Prokaryotes,像Myxococcus xanthus,表现出复杂的社会行为,包括合作发展.
研究的目的:
- 调查细菌Myxococcus xanthus.在社会作弊的存在和流行情况.
- 为了确定进化或突变的M. xanthus基因型是否在合作开发过程中表现出作弊行为.
主要方法:
- 检查了M. xanthus的基因型,其中存在果实体发育缺陷.
- 测试了进化的线条 (1000代在非社会条件下) 和定义的突变.
- 通过将突变/进化菌株与熟练的祖先混合并分析子表征来评估作弊.
主要成果:
- 几种M. xanthus进化了线条和两个定义的突变体证明了社会作弊.
- 与最初的频率相比,作弊者基因型在由此产生的子群体中占有过多的比例.
- 这项研究强调了自然M. xanthus种群中反社会行为的潜在共同点.
结论:
- 社会欺骗是Myxococcus xanthus.hus的社会动态的一个重要因素.
- 这些发现表明,作弊机制很容易被检测到,并且可能在 prokaryotic 社会系统中广泛传播.

Synthetic biology is an interdisciplinary science that involves using principles from disciplines such as engineering, molecular biology, cell biology, and systems biology. It involves remodeling existing organisms from nature or constructing completely new synthetic organisms for applications such as protein or enzyme production, bioremediation, value-added macromolecule production, and the addition of desirable traits to crops, to name a few.

Organisms are capable of detecting and fixing nucleotide mismatches that occur during DNA replication. This sophisticated process requires identifying the new strand and replacing the erroneous bases with correct nucleotides. Mismatch repair is coordinated by many proteins in both prokaryotes and eukaryotes.
